2020 Grocery Digital Maturity Benchmark Reveals New Leader

While the overall grocery retail segment grew 8 percent in Q2 2020 compared to Q2 2019, Incisiv’s second annual Grocery Digital Maturity Benchmark, sponsored by Mercatus, FlyBuy and ShopperKit, found that the top 25 percent of the most digitally mature retailers grew 19 percent, or 2.4 times the industry average. Save Mart Co. Partners With Starship On Contactless Robotic Delivery

The Save Mart Cos., based in Modesto, California, recently announced the launch of an on-demand grocery delivery service to its customers at the Save Mart flagship store in Modesto in partnership with robot delivery company, Starship Technologies. Schnuck Markets Deploys Tally Robot To More Than Half Of Stores

Three years after introducing Simbe Robotics’ autonomous robot Tally to select stores to enhance inventory management, St. Louis, Missouri-based Schnuck Markets announced it is launching the technology in an additional 46 stores. Meijer Partners With FourKites On Purchase Order Lifecycle Visibility

Chicago-based FourKites, a real-time supply chain visibility platform, has introduced multimodal purchase order (PO) tracking for all freight in the FourKites system. This new capability gives shippers, carriers and receivers the power, flexibility and granularity to track the full lifecycle of shipments using their associated PO numbers.
